The Role of Compliance Auditing Services in Modern Businesses

In today’s regulatory-driven world, businesses face increasing pressure to meet environmental, health, and safety (EHS) standards. Failing to comply with these regulations can result in legal penalties, fines, and damage to a company’s reputation. This is where Compliance Auditing Services come into play. These services are designed to evaluate a company’s adherence to applicable laws, regulations, and internal policies. By conducting thorough audits, businesses can identify areas where they may be falling short and take corrective action before problems arise. Compliance Auditing Services not only ensure that companies meet their legal obligations but also improve workplace accountability by fostering a culture of responsibility, transparency, and proactive management.

The Financial Impact of Accountability in Compliance

Maintaining accountability through Compliance Auditing Services has clear financial benefits. Companies that take compliance seriously and implement proper auditing practices are less likely to face expensive fines, penalties, or lawsuits. By addressing potential issues early through regular audits, businesses can avoid costly mistakes that would otherwise impact their bottom line. Furthermore, EHS Consulting Services often uncover inefficiencies that, when corrected, result in cost savings. For example, improving energy use, waste management, and operational procedures can lead to reduced expenses and enhanced profitability. Companies that prioritize compliance and accountability are often seen as more reliable and trustworthy by clients, partners, and investors, which can further improve their financial stability and reputation.
